Transaction d6e75a75ed70a26800af0cca48180947024c4edfc24710b74fcceb95c0ca1458
3 Input
2 Outputs
- d6e75a75ed70a26800af0cca48180947024c4edfc24710b74fcceb95c0ca1458:0
- d6e75a75ed70a26800af0cca48180947024c4edfc24710b74fcceb95c0ca1458:1
value 534907
address 38d5eAt4SahmXdRVma5DcFhF7kEnnakGes
value 14444690
address 3Mrq3JAaxaoz7j1xup1mUAqbJKB7QZQg6x